Yet there are under the abused words ideas which should be the guide of life.
The third is "Love"-- an earnest and intense desire for the welfare of our fellow-men, keen joy in their happiness, keen sorrow in their troubles.

The word is out and shall not, except perhaps in a quotation, be used again.

To use the word lightly or without grave reason seems almost a breach of the third clause of the Decalogue, remembering what is said to be its equivalent by one who of all men who have lived had the most intimate means of knowing.

All work of reconstruction must be inspired by a spirit of true philanthropy; without that the labour is in vain.

There is no other motive power that can move the world in the path of true progress.
It will be said that this is both obvious and to be ignored--a platitude with a flavour of cant.
